About Cathryn N. Mitchell

Cathryn N. Mitchell is a scholar working on Astronomy and Astrophysics, Aerospace Engineering, Geophysics, Molecular Biology and Oceanography, having authored 147 papers that have together received 3.2k indexed citations. Recurring topics across this work include Ionosphere and magnetosphere dynamics (112 papers), GNSS positioning and interference (83 papers), Earthquake Detection and Analysis (69 papers), Geomagnetism and Paleomagnetism Studies (27 papers), Geophysics and Gravity Measurements (22 papers), Solar and Space Plasma Dynamics (19 papers), Geophysical and Geoelectrical Methods (8 papers) and Medical Imaging Techniques and Applications (7 papers). The work is most often cited by research in Astronomy and Astrophysics (2.5k citations), Geophysics (1.4k citations), Aerospace Engineering (1.7k citations), Oceanography (627 citations) and Atmospheric Science (191 citations). Cathryn N. Mitchell has collaborated with scholars based in United Kingdom, United States and Italy. Frequent co-authors include P.S. Spencer, G. S. Bust, Lucilla Alfonsi, Giorgiana De Franceschi, Vincenzo Romano, Massimo Materassi, L. Kersley, Alex T. Chartier, S. E. Pryse and A. W. Wernik. Their work appears in journals such as Radio Science, Journal of Atmospheric and Solar-Terrestrial Physics, Annales Geophysicae, Advances in Space Research and Journal of Geophysical Research Atmospheres.
